General Description

  • Performs a variety of duties related to planning, estimating, scheduling and field coordination activities to construction activities.

Advantages

This is an opportunity to work with a renowned company at a competitve rate.

Responsibilities

  • Prepares detailed cost estimates by considering engineering specifications and contract conditions; research, analyzes and recommends best methods and procedures to minimize labour and equipment requirements, associated costs and / or scheduling impacts; revises estimates and schedules.
  • Prepares quantity takeoffs for a wide range of materials and components; prepares quantity and costs calculations on the direct costs of material and components by using either established unit cost and productivity rate information or estimating from base information; assesses risk situations and allows for in estimating process and pricing of work.
  • Applies established markups to direct cost components to ensure recovery of full overhead expense.
  • Prepares work schedules and coordinates activities on assigned projects. May be required to design drawings including drafting and perform survey of sites
